Can iLO2 logs be collected centrally ?

Customer wants to know if the info in the iLO2 log can be collected centrally? They have a large number of ProLiant servers and use iLO2 extensively and are required to inspect iLO2 logs periodically for errors, security breaches, etc.

 

We had some responses from Jeroen and  Doug:

Doug said:

You can use …

 

cd /map1/log1

show -a

 

… to retrieve all of the iLO event log

 

 

Another alternative is to use CPQLOCFG and the XML scripts Get_iLO_Log.xml (for the iLO event log) and/or Get_IML.xml (for the ProLiant IML).  You probably will want to parse the XML output into something more storage friendly.

Jeroen had this to say:

 

*****************************************************************************************************************

You didn’t specify if you run this on ML/DL’s or on Blades.
But just in case this customer has blades, then he can execute the OA CLI command:

 -show syslog ilo all 

and review it; it would need only OA FW 3.00 to be installed (just released).

If the customer would run the OA CLI: show all command this information will be included as well in the report.
